Compact yet Powerful Storage Solution
Synology DiskStation DS218+ is designed for home users or small businesses pursuing a
compact and reliable shared storage solution, oering the exibility to expand the
2 GB RAM to up to 6 GB RAM to process intensive workloads. DS218+ features a
dual-core 2.0 GHz processor with a burst frequency of 2.5 GHz. With AES-NI, DS218+
delivers encrypted performance of up to 113 MB/s reading and 112 MB/s writing under
RAID 1 conguration
1
.
DS218+ comes with three USB 3.0 ports. The hot-swappable drive tray design allows
easy installation and maintenance on 3.5-inch HDDs without additional tools.
Btrfs: Next Generation Storage
DS218+ integrates Btrfs le system, bringing the most advanced storage technologies
to meet the management needs of small businesses:
Flexible Shared Folder/User Quota System provides comprehensive quota control on
all user accounts and shared folders.
Advanced snapshot technology with customizable backup schedule allows up to
1,024 copies of shared folder backups and 65,000 copies of system-wide snapshots,
without occupying huge storage capacity and system resources.
File or folder level data restoration brings huge convenience and saves time for users
who wish to restore only a specic le or folder.
Cloud Station with le versioning requires less than half of the storage space when
compared with ext4 le systems.
